diff --git a/drivers/tty/serial/Kconfig b/drivers/tty/serial/Kconfig
index f51a8079f1f5..80321b9c4465 100644
--- a/drivers/tty/serial/Kconfig
+++ b/drivers/tty/serial/Kconfig
@@ -1443,6 +1443,7 @@ config SERIAL_STM32_CONSOLE
bool "Support for console on STM32"
depends on SERIAL_STM32=y
select SERIAL_CORE_CONSOLE
+ select SERIAL_EARLYCON

diff --git a/drivers/tty/serial/stm32-usart.c b/drivers/tty/serial/stm32-usart.c
index 8aefb286bd88..f75691e72729 100644
--- a/drivers/tty/serial/stm32-usart.c
+++ b/drivers/tty/serial/stm32-usart.c
@@ -1761,6 +1761,57 @@ static struct console stm32_console = {
#define STM32_SERIAL_CONSOLE NULL
#endif /* CONFIG_SERIAL_STM32_CONSOLE */
+#ifdef CONFIG_SERIAL_EARLYCON
+static void early_stm32_usart_console_putchar(struct uart_port *port, unsigned char ch)
+{
+ struct stm32_usart_info *info = port->private_data;
+
+ while (!(readl_relaxed(port->membase + info->ofs.isr) & USART_SR_TXE))
+ cpu_relax();
+
+ writel_relaxed(ch, port->membase + info->ofs.tdr);
+}
+
+static void early_stm32_serial_write(struct console *console, const char *s, unsigned int count)
+{
+ struct earlycon_device *device = console->data;
+ struct uart_port *port = &device->port;
+
+ uart_console_write(port, s, count, early_stm32_usart_console_putchar);
+}
+
+static int __init early_stm32_h7_serial_setup(struct earlycon_device *device, const char *options)
+{
+ if (!(device->port.membase || device->port.iobase))
+ return -ENODEV;
+ device->port.private_data = &stm32h7_info;
+ device->con->write = early_stm32_serial_write;
+ return 0;
+}
+
+static int __init early_stm32_f7_serial_setup(struct earlycon_device *device, const char *options)
+{
+ if (!(device->port.membase || device->port.iobase))
+ return -ENODEV;
+ device->port.private_data = &stm32f7_info;
+ device->con->write = early_stm32_serial_write;
+ return 0;
+}
+
+static int __init early_stm32_f4_serial_setup(struct earlycon_device *device, const char *options)
+{
+ if (!(device->port.membase || device->port.iobase))
+ return -ENODEV;
+ device->port.private_data = &stm32f4_info;
+ device->con->write = early_stm32_serial_write;
+ return 0;
+}
+
+OF_EARLYCON_DECLARE(stm32, "st,stm32h7-uart", early_stm32_h7_serial_setup);
+OF_EARLYCON_DECLARE(stm32, "st,stm32f7-uart", early_stm32_f7_serial_setup);
+OF_EARLYCON_DECLARE(stm32, "st,stm32-uart", early_stm32_f4_serial_setup);
+#endif /* CONFIG_SERIAL_EARLYCON */
